*plant optimization specialist*
*san luis potosí - méxico*
*primary purpose of the position*
- execute daily plant optimization activities and ensure follow-up, where required, to support a successful and sustainable implementation plant optimization in the plant.
- drive "people & environmental care" as a value and help to build a culture of "zero loss" while ensuring "one goodyear way".
focus on our guiding principles of safety, quality & excellence.
- serve as a change agent for plant optimization by driving process discipline, quality focus, transparency, and accountability.
- provide clear, concise, and direct feedback to plant optimization leader and manufacturing unit leadership on successes and challenges during implementations.
*principle duties and responsibilities*
- provide support to the manufacturing unit leadership and plant optimization leader on po sustainment (pillars, dms, zero loss).
support in the development of po strategy with pol & manufacturing unit leadership.
teach, train & coach all levels of the organization in po.
coordinate po activities in the business center.
- ensure robust po processes and process health.
conduct audits to validate & further develop the team.
support implementation and monitoring of mu layered audit process (pec, wpo, dec).
ensure boards are updated and po tools being used appropriately.
escalate deficiencies to pol & mum when progress is at risk.
- support daily management system execution.
ensure dms drives performance, coach discipline for correct reaction to red.
help to create and drive towards an operating plan.
- capture and communicate status & lessons learned.
create a culture of celebrating success.
identify blockers and report results to management.
- use po to drive empowerment and accountability to floor.
open sharing between manufacturing units.
follow "one goodyear way" to ensure successful & sustainable implementation.
*education*
- bachelor's degree or equivalent experience.
*experience*
- minimum 3 years of working experience in a manufacturing environment.
- experience in lean manufacturing systems and methods (5s, tpm, vsm/flow, problem solving tools & continuous improvement projects).
- good understanding of the overall plant optimization (lean manufacturing) process & methods.
- internal: previous experience as a hpt or site pillar leader in plant optimization is desired.
- external: prior experience working in a tpm & lean manufacturing system.
- knowledge & skills
*knowledge & skills*
- strong team building & interpersonal skills.
- strong communication skills, basic understanding of human psychology.
- str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
- strong project & time management skills, manage various priorities & resolve conflict.
- knowledge of lean tools (5s, pull / kanban / vsm, kaizen events, smed, dmaic, tpm).
- computer literate (microsoft products: excel, powerpoint, word).
- must have an advanced excel level (power automate)
- fluency in spanish and english.
